Fish Tacos with Corn Salsa


This one is super quick, easy and healthy too!


Ingredients

For the fish:
2 lbs white fish filets (tilapia, cod, mahi mahi, catfish, or snapper)
2 limes, cut into wedges
3 garlic cloves, minced
1/2 tsp cumin
1/2 tsp chili powder
1/4 tsp cayenne pepper
1/2 tsp garlic salt
1/4 tsp salt
1/4 tsp pepper
4 tbsp oil

Corn Salsa:
1 cup corn
1/2 red onion, diced
1 bunch cilantro, chopped
1 jalapeno, diced finely
soft tortillas

Garnishes:
avocado
sour cream
hot sauce
salsa
shredded cheese

Preheat oven to 425.

Spray a baking dish with cooking spray.
Place fish filets in dish, sprinkle with half of the cumin, chili powder, cayenne, garlic salt, pepper and salt. Turn filets over and sprinkle the rest of the spices.




Drizzle half the oil and rub into the filets. Turn over and repeat.


Spread out garlic cloves over the fish. Squeeze juice from half of a lime onto the fish.


Bake in oven for 15 minutes or until fish is flaky.

Meanwhile, prepare the salsa.
Combine onions, cilantro, jalapeno, and corn in a dish.
Squeeze another half of a lime over. Mix well.



Combine some of the flaked fish and salsa in a tortilla. Garnish with avocado, sour cream, cheese and/or hot sauce. Serve with the remaining lime wedges.
